Turner Industries is a fully diversified industrial contractor that provides responsive, innovative solutions to increase plant production, reduce costs, and prevent shutdowns in industries such as petrochemical, refining, energy, and pulp and paper. Headquartered in Baton Rouge, LA, Turner Industries has over 20,000 employees across the United States. The company is committed to its people, prioritizing their safety, security, and satisfaction. Turner Industries Group, LLC has an opening for a Mechanical Planner to join their Project Controls Team. This role will be placed at a jobsite in Baton Rouge, LA or the surrounding area. The Mechanical Planner will be responsible for tasks related to equipment, piping, structural steel, and light civil work. Responsibilities include walking down job scope requests, estimating labor hours for various disciplines, developing work plans, and creating job plan packages. The candidate may be tasked with planning Maintenance, Turnarounds, Small Capital Projects, or a combination thereof.

Responsibilities

  • Walking down job scope requests
  • Estimating labor hours for multiple disciplines
  • Developing work plans
  • Creating job plan packages
  • Planning Maintenance, Turnarounds, Small Capital Projects, or a combination of the three
  • Reviewing specifications, drawings, etc. to determine scope of work and required contents of estimate
  • Preparing estimates by calculating complete takeoff of scope of work, material, outside services and sub-contractors
  • Reviewing and incorporating historical data into a number of resources and man-hours estimates
  • Estimating extras, change orders, and discovery work items
  • Maintaining files of working documents and backup estimate figures
